Daftar Isi
- Apa yang dimaksud dengan Asynchronous pada Javascript dan Mengapa Sangat Penting|Definisi Asinkron di JavaScript dan Mengapa Ini Penting|Apa yang Asinkron pada Javascript serta Mengapa Penting untuk Dipahami
- Pendekatan Asinkron: Promise, Async dan Await, dan Panggi balik
- Manfaat Pemakaian Asynchronous dalam rangka Meningkatkan Performa Program
Memahami Pemahaman Asinkron Dalam Javascript adalah langkah pertama untuk esensial bagi developer dalam mengembangkan aplikasi yang lebih interaktif serta efisien. Dalam alam pemrograman Internet, khususnya Javascript, studi mengenai ide asynchronous sangatlah krusial. Dengan memahami metode kerja asinkron, kamu dapat menghindari permasalahan yang timbul akibat pemrosesan yang secara berurutan. Ayo sama-sama eksplor lebih dalam tentang Mengidentifikasi dan menggunakan Konsep Asinkron Di JavaScript agar project kamu dapat jadi berhasil.
Dalam tulisan ini, kita berencana untuk membahas berbagai aspek mengena gagasan asynchronous di Javascript, seperti kemampuan yang memfasilitasi termasuk fungsi callback, janji asli, dan async/await. Dengan memahami konsep ini, kamu akan dapat memperbaiki efisiensi program anda sekalian dan memberikan pengalaman pengguna yang optimal. Khususnya pada pengembangan aplikasi yang membutuhkan proses data dari sumber sistem penyimpanan dan antarmuka aplikasi, memanfaatkan gagasan asinkron dalam Javascript akan menawarkan jawaban yang ideal untuk tantangan keterlambatan serta efisiensi yang sering dihadapi.
Apa yang dimaksud dengan Asynchronous pada Javascript dan Mengapa Sangat Penting|Definisi Asinkron di JavaScript dan Mengapa Ini Penting|Apa yang Asinkron pada Javascript serta Mengapa Penting untuk Dipahami
Memahami istilah asynchronous di JavaScript adalah tahapan krusial bagi pengembang yang ingin meningkatkan keahlian coding mereka. Asinkron mengizinkan kita untuk menjalankan kode tanpa harus menunggu tahapan yang memakan waktu selesai, seperti permintaan jaringan atau pembacaan file. Dengan mengerti bagaimana asinkron bekerja, kita bisa meningkatkan performa aplikasi web dan menghadirkan pengalaman user yang lebih responsif. Hal ini sangat penting dalam pengembangan aplikasi modern yang bergantung pada komunikasi real time dan pemrosesan data yang instan.
Dalam konteks Javascript, ide asynchronous sering diimplementasikan dengan callback, janji, dan async dan await. Tiga teknik ini memudahkan kita mengatur operasi yang berjalan secara paralel, sehingga kita dapat mengeksekusi kode lain selagi menantikan output dari tugas yang lebih berat. Memahami konsep asynchronous di Javascript bukan hanya memperkaya pengetahuan kita tetapi juga memberikan tools yang dibutuhkan untuk mengatasi hambatan seputar pengembangan aplikasi skala besar.
Keberadaan asynchronous dalam Javascript sangat esensial untuk menjamin bahwa aplikasi yang kita buat tidak sekadar berfungsi secara optimal, tetapi juga memberikan pengalaman pengguna yang terbaik. Jika tidak menggunakan strategi asynchronous, program kita cenderung mengalami lag atau bahkan terjadi reaksi lambat saat mesti mengerjakan operasi berat. Dengan cara mengetahui ide asynchronous di Javascript, kita dapat mengoptimalkan potensi maksimal dari bahasa ini ini hingga membuat aplikasi yang lebih efektif serta ramah pengguna.
Pendekatan Asinkron: Promise, Async dan Await, dan Panggi balik
Mengetahui Konsep Asynchronous Dalam Javascript sangat penting bagi development software website yang responsive. Dalam dunia programming, terutama pada Javascript, fungsi yg dilaksanakan dengan cara asinkron memungkinkan anda untuk melakukan menjalankan beberapa tugas dalam keadaan simultan tanpa harus harus menunggu satu tahapan selesai dulu. Hal ini sangat berguna untuk meningkatkan performa aplikasi, terutama ketika menghadapi dalam hal Input/Output, seperti request jaringan atau mengakses berkas. Melalui pengetahuan yang kuat mengenai cara kerja asynchronous, contohnya Promise, Async/Await, dan Callback, kita dapat menulis program yg lebih efisien serta mudah dipahami.
Salah satu umum dipakai untuk Memahami Ide Asynchronous Di JavaScript merupakan penggunaan Promise. Promise berperan sebagai sarana komponen yang mewakili hasil akhir dari sebuah proses asynchronous yang kemungkinan tidak selesai di waktu ini. Saat satu Promise selesai, entah secara sukses maupun tidak berhasil, itu hendak memberi output yang dapat kita tangani dengan metode sebagaimana .then() bagi hasil sukses atau .catch() bagi mengurus Situs pengawas4d kesalahan. Dengan Promise, kita dapat menyusun kode yang lebih teratur dan tertata dibandingkan menggunakan Callback, yang seringkali menghasilkan yang disebutkan ‘Callback Hell’.
Dalam perkembangan selanjutnya tentang Mengenal Konsep Asinkron Di Javascript, Async dan Await muncul sebagai solusi solusi yang lebih elegan bagus dalam mengatasi proses asinkron. Async dan Await memfasilitasi kita agar membuat kode asinkron secara metode seperti serupa dari kode synchronous, sehingga menjadi ringan dibaca oleh orang dan di-debug. Dengan menandakan fungsi-fungsi menggunakan keyword ‘async’ serta menggunakan ‘await’ sebelum janji, kita mampu menyusun kode yang tampak, walaupun dalam belakang layar tetap melakukan proses asynchronous. Strategi ini meningkatkan pengalaman para developer dalam memanipulasi dalam kode asynchronous serta membuat JavaScript lebih tangguh pada pengembangan aplikasi masa kini.
Manfaat Pemakaian Asynchronous dalam rangka Meningkatkan Performa Program
Mengenal konsep asinkron di JavaScript sungguh esensial bagi para developer yang berharap membangun kinerja program yang mereka buat. Konsep ini mengizinkan eksekusi tugas yang tidak harus menunggu proses lain selesai, sehingga program bisa tetap siap merespons. Dalam konteks ini, pemanfaatan asinkron bisa mengurangi waktu penantian dan memperbaiki kesan user, terutama pada program yang mengharuskan pengambilan informasi dari pelayan maupun pemrosesan informasi yang berat.
Dengan cara menerapkan dan menerapkan konsep asynchronous dalam Java Script, pengembang dapat menggunakan kemampuan sebagaimana Promises dan async dan await yang mana memudahkan mengelola operasi yang bersifat tidak menghalangi. Ini artinya, ketika program melakukan panggilan API atau perlu melaksanakan tugas yang kompleks, user masih dapat berinteraksi program tanpa merasakan lag. Selain itu, manajemen kesalahan juga lebih efektif juga dapat dapat terlaksana berkat penggunaan asynchronous.
Selain itu efisiensi aplikasi, mengetahui konsep asynchronous di JavaScript juga turut berkontribusi dalam optimalisasi sumber daya. Dengan menggunakan cara kerja asynchronous, tekanan pada server bisa karena operasi tidak perlu diakses secara sekuensial. Ini berarti bahwa lebih banyak permintaan dapat dilayani dalam waktu yang serentak, yang pada gilirannya dapat mendorong efisiensi aplikasi secara keseluruhan dan memberikan kepuasan yang lebih bagi pemakai.